Drilling Equipment
Drilling is the first step in any mining operation, and modern drilling rigs are engineered for precision and power. Rotary drills, blast hole drills, and underground drilling machines are commonly used to create boreholes for explosives or exploration. These machines feature automated controls, high torque capabilities, and durable components to withstand abrasive rock formations. Advanced models also incorporate GPS and telemetry systems for accurate hole placement and real-time monitoring.

Crushing and Grinding Machinery
Once raw material is extracted, it must be broken down into manageable sizes for further processing. Jaw crushers, cone crushers, and impact crushers are widely used in primary and secondary crushing stages. For finer grinding, ball mills and SAG mills pulverize ore into slurry or powder. These machines are built with wear-resistant materials to minimize downtime caused by abrasion. Automated systems adjust settings dynamically to maintain optimal throughput while reducing energy consumption.

Material Handling Systems
Efficient transportation of mined material is crucial for maintaining workflow continuity. Conveyor belts, stackers, reclaimers, and loaders form the backbone of material handling in mining facilities. Heavy-duty conveyors transport bulk materials over long distances with minimal human intervention. Stackers organize stockpiles systematically while reclaimers feed material back into the production line as needed.
